Method And System of Using Social Networks and Communities to Ensure Data Quality of Configuration Items in a Configuration Management Database
First Claim
1. A computer implemented method for maintaining data quality of configuration items in a configuration management database of an enterprise, the computer performing the steps of:
- enabling configuration items to be organized into communities;
enabling association of individuals with one or more of said communities, each individual associated with a community having particular expertise within the enterprise with respect to one or more configuration items in the community;
enabling an individual in the community to view the configuration items in the community;
enabling the individual to add or delete or otherwise update one of the configuration items or its attributes, where the configuration item touches upon the particular expertise of the individual; and
displaying said configuration item update to other individuals associated with communities containing the configuration item.

Abstract
A method and system are described for distributing the tasks of ensuring the accuracy and currency of data contained in a CMDB to a social network of communities within the organization. Configuration items (CIs) are organized into Communities, and Users are associated with these Communities. Users associated with a Community search or browse for a CI and review the accuracy of a CI attribute, making correction by modification, deletion or addition. If correct information is not known the user tags the CI attribute for later correction. Corrections are reviewed and either approved or reverted back to the original value of the CI attribute. Through iteration of the process the accuracy of the CMDB is improved.
